Mail delivery delayed for sewer authority bills

The Coaldale-Lansford-Summit Hill Joint Sewer Authority has issued an alert to its customers regarding a mail delivery problem that happened in the last week of December and still has not been resolved. The fourth quarter sewer bills for customers in Lansford and Coaldale are not being delivered.

In a press release, the authority said:

“On Dec. 27, 2024, the fourth quarter sewer bills were delivered to the U.S. Post Office in Lehighton, PA, as the standard procedures of the sewer authority office.

“It was brought to the authority’s attention in early January that residents of Lansford and Coaldale boroughs did not receive their fourth quarter bills in the mail. The authority office employees have been in contact with the U.S. Postal Service (Lehigh Valley, Lehighton and Lansford offices) in an attempt to identify the problem with the mail deliveries. As of this date, the problem has not been corrected by the USPS. Office employees are continuing to work with the USPS.

“The tentative due date for the fourth quarter billing is Jan. 20, 2025. Authority customers are urged to contact the authority office, by phone or in person, to determine their fourth quarter bill amount. A due date extension will be made and determined after the problem is identified and resolved by the USPS.”
